HSY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2020 in Review

925 of the 4,956 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Hershey (HSY) for Q3 2020, worth a combined $15.6B — up 7.7% from $14.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 89 funds opened new HSY positions and 69 closed out — a net gain of 20 holders — while 278 added to existing stakes and 331 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Victory Capital Management, adding an estimated $185M. The largest seller was Renaissance Technologies, cutting an estimated $149M.
